Output 0e4b5e6d1ad4e4cd6a8b806830996b9636dfb57cc0b85962847886ebc5126407:75

value
282791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f0d52d81a7ac28b9e456e2359b0378e381a2d9 OP_EQUAL
address
3DuEJQdszaAikqX713JxV6cE4Pqja5FE3x
transaction
0e4b5e6d1ad4e4cd6a8b806830996b9636dfb57cc0b85962847886ebc5126407
confirmations
245053
spent
true